Job Overview:
Under general supervision, fabricates aircraft furniture and other wood-surfaced subassemblies using aircraft specifications, design and engineering drawings with a high level of safety, quality, detail and productivity. Assists team members with greater experience to enhance techniques supportive of quality workmanship.
Job Description :
1. Works under general supervision to fabricate furniture and other wood-surfaced subassemblies using blueprints, aircraft specifications and design/engineering drawings. . 2. Assembles, pins and glues cabinet shells. Installs drawer-slides, hinges, latches and other hardware in subassemblies. Applies exterior surface materials such as laminates, veneers, and cap strips. 3. Uses various types of stationary and hand-held power tools to fabricate or disassemble furniture. 4. Complies with all safety, 5S, and housekeeping policies. Uses personal protective equipment to protect aircraft interior. 5. Uses the material tracking system to create parts demand, track squawks and to sign-off work. .
